**Ticket: Signature check failed on pricing experiment rollout**

The FareSplit ticket-pricing experiment bundle failed verification during last night's deploy — the pipeline rejected it as unsigned. Root cause: the experiment config was built on a laptop without the release toolchain. Rebuild through the Ashfield pipeline and re-sign. For reference, verification runs against the key below.

signing key of fawif-fafog = bky13_mbeCN7uvMrNDc

Subject: DR Drill — SquatWatch Scanner Failover, Thursday

Hi Mirela,

As release manager, please confirm the Thursday drill window for SquatWatch, our typo-squatting package scanner. We'll simulate loss of the Verlune datacenter, restore the registry mirror from cold snapshots, and replay the last six hours of scan queues. Expect roughly forty minutes of degraded alerting; the on-call rotation has been briefed. Before the drill, verify you can unlock the sealed restore vault. For that step you will need the passphrase below.

unlock words, fafop-hawep: briwyn-oliix-sorox

Env vars for the Quillbrook spreadsheet exporter, quick notes for review: EXPORT_STREAMING=true keeps memory flat on big sheets, EXPORT_CHUNK_ROWS caps buffered rows (we use 1500). Nothing spicy there. The only sensitive bit is the checksum signing secret the exporter needs at boot, which lives in the env file on the line right after this one.

vault entry, fawip-kageg: RELAY_SECRET20=bdc404df98d1e5f35869

Night-Shift Access — Support Team (Hallowick Annex). Support staff on the 22:00–06:00 rotation enter via door C2 only. Main lobby locked after 21:30. Log all entries in the desk register. Escalations go to the Quorrel facilities line. Badge readers on C2 run in offline mode overnight. Issue night staff the standing access code below.

badge for bahop-kahop: bdg-YHM-0

Handing off the Quillbus broker upgrade (4.x to 5.1) to Dario. Cluster is half-migrated; mixed-version mode is supported but TLS cert rotation must finish before cutover. No auth model changes, though the admin API gained two new endpoints worth reviewing. Open questions and the migration checklist are tracked on the internal page below.

dashboard of taduf-bawef = https://jira.lumicsys.internal/projects/display/browse/b1cbf89d